Understanding the Prompt

It is important to read the prompt and understand it before you begin writing. Make note of specific instructions (such as formatting guidelines or word limits) and the main themes or questions addressed by the prompt. It will give you a direction to follow and keep you focused.


Brainstorm and Research

When you understand the question, start researching the subject. Consult reputable sources such as scholarly articles, books, and credible websites to gather information and support for your arguments. Take detailed notes on your ideas and sources.

After gathering your research, take some time to brainstorm and organize your thoughts. You can use a map or an outline to see the overall structure of your paper and how your arguments flow. This step is important to ensure that you are organized.

  • Introduction: Start your essay with an engaging hook to grab the reader’s attention. Give some background on the subject and introduce your thesis statement. This is the argument or viewpoint you’ll be discussing in the essay.
  • The main body paragraphs are devoted to a specific idea, argument or thesis. Start each paragraph by introducing the topic with a sentence. Then, provide examples or analyses to back up your argument.
  • In conclusion, restate and summarize your key points in a concise and powerful manner. Avoid introducing new information in the conclusion and leave the reader with a thought-provoking ending.


The Writing Process

It is now time to begin writing your essay. Begin with the introduction and gradually develop each body paragraph, ensuring a smooth transition between ideas. Be sure to back up your claims with evidence from scholarly resources and include citations where necessary.

Attention to tone and grammar is important when you write. Be sure to use simple and clear sentences. Do not overuse jargon, technical terms, or excessively complex language. Instead, aim for an authoritative, professional tone. Use persuasive techniques like rhetorical questions and logical reasoning, as well as a variety of sentence structures to keep your reader engaged.


Editing

Take a break and allow yourself time to revise your essay after you finish the first draft. You can then re-visit your essay and correct any mistakes or improve areas.

Concentrate on improving the quality of your written work. Check for grammar and spelling mistakes, as well as any inconsistencies in your arguments or logical flow. You can gain valuable insight by asking a colleague or friend for their feedback.
